99743561 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 99743562. Its totient is φ = 99743560.
The previous prime is 99743491. The next prime is 99743563. The reversal of 99743561 is 16534799.
It is a strong prime.
It can be written as a sum of positive squares in only one way, i.e., 96904336 + 2839225 = 9844^2 + 1685^2 .
It is an emirp because it is prime and its reverse (16534799) is a distict prime.
It is a cyclic number.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 99743561 - 222 = 95549257 is a prime.
Together with 99743563, it forms a pair of twin primes.
It is a Chen prime.
It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(99743563) by changing a digit.
It is a pernicious number, because its binary representation contains a prime number (17) of ones.
It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 49871780 + 49871781.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(49871781).
Almost surely, 299743561 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
99743561 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1).
99743561 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.
99743561 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.
The product of its digits is 204120, while the sum is 44.
The square root of 99743561 is about 9987.1698193232. The cubic root of 99743561 is about 463.7617822606.
